2x/9 +x/3 = 13/6, solve for x
Answer:
x = 3 9/10
Step-by-step explanation:
2x/9 +x/3 = 13/6
Get a common denominator on the left side
2x/9 + x/3 *3/3 = 13/6
2x/9 + 3x/9 = 13/6
5x/9 = 13/6
Multiply each side by 9/5 to isolate x
5x/9 *9/5 = 13/6 * 9/5
x = 117/30
Divide the top and bottom by 3
x = 39/10
x = 3 9/10

A study of long-distance phone calls made from General Electric Corporate Headquarters in Fairfield, Connecticut, revealed the length of the calls, in minutes, follows the normal probability distribution. The mean length of time per call was 3.5 minutes and the standard deviation was 0.70 minutes. What is the probability that calls last between 3.5 and 4.0 minutes? (Round your z value to 2 decimal places and final answer to 4 decimal places.)
Answer:
0.2611
Step-by-step explanation:
Given the following information :
Normal distribution:
Mean (m) length of time per call = 3.5 minutes
Standard deviation (sd) = 0.7 minutes
Probability that length of calls last between 3.5 and 4.0 minutes :
P(3.5 < x < 4):
Find z- score of 3.5:
z = (x - m) / sd
x = 3.5
z = (3.5 - 3.5) / 0.7 = 0
x = 4
z = (4.0 - 3.5) / 0.7 = 0.5 / 0.7 = 0.71
P(3.5 < x < 4) = P( 0 < z < 0.714)
From the z - distribution table :
0 = 0.500
0.71 = very close to 0.7611
(0.7611 - 0.5000) = 0.2611
P(3.5 < x < 4) = P( 0 < z < 0.714) = 0.2611

a scout troop is making care packages for soldiers. Each package has 126 grams of gronola, 245 grams of chocolate chip cookies , and 325 grams of nuts in it. if they have 16 care packages, what is the total weight of the food in all of the packages?
Answer: 11136 grams
≈ 11.14 kilograms
Step-by-step explanation:
Given, Each package has 126 grams of granola, 245 grams of chocolate chip cookies , and 325 grams of nuts in it.
Total weight of each package = 126 grams + 245 grams + 325 grams
= 696 grams
If they have 16 care packages, then total weight of packages = 16 x (Total weight of each package)
= 16 x 696 grams
= 11136 grams
≈ 11.14 kilograms [ 1 kilogram = 1000 grams]

In a circle whose center is O, arc AB contaisn 100 degrees. Find the number of degrees in angle ABO?
Answer:
40
Step-by-step explanation:
Angles ABO, BAO, and AOB are the angles of isosceles triangle AOB. The angles at A and B are equal, so we have ...
AOB +2ABO = 180° . . . . . sum of angles in the triangle
100° +2ABO = 180° . . . . . . use the given value
50° +ABO = 90° . . . . . . . . divide by 2; next, subtract 50°
∠ABO = 40°

A study was conducted on students from a particular high school over the last 8 years. The following information was found regarding standardized tests used for college admitance. Scores on the SAT test are normally distributed with a mean of 982 and a standard deviation of 198. Scores on the ACT test are normally distributed with a mean of 19.6 and a standard deviation of 4.5. It is assumed that the two tests measure the same aptitude, but use different scales.If a student gets an SAT score that is the 20-percentile, find the actual SAT score.SAT score =What would be the equivalent ACT score for this student?ACT score =If a student gets an SAT score of 1437, find the equivalent ACT score.ACT score =
Answer:
Actual SAT Score = 815.284
Equivalent ACT Score = 15.811
The equivalent ACT Score = 29.95
Step-by-step explanation:
From the given information:
Scores on the SAT test are normally distributed with :
Mean = 982
Standard deviation = 198
If a student gets an SAT score that is the 20-percentile
Then ;
P(Z ≤ z ) = 0.20
From the standard z-score for percentile distribution.
z = -0.842
Therefore, the actual SAT Score can be computed as follows:
Actual SAT score = Mean + (z score × Standard deviation)
Actual SAT score = 982 + (- 0.842 × 198)
Actual SAT score = 982 + ( - 166.716)
Actual SAT score = 982 - 166.716
Actual SAT Score = 815.284
Scores on the ACT test are normally distributed with a mean of 19.6 and a standard deviation of 4.5.
Mean = 19.6
Standard deviation = 4.5
Equivalent ACT Score = 19.6 + (- 0.842 × 4.5)
Equivalent ACT Score = 19.6 + ( - 3.789)
Equivalent ACT Score = 15.811
If a student gets an SAT score of 1437, find the equivalent ACT score.
So , if the SAT Score = 1437
Then , using the z formula , we can determine the equivalent ACT Score
[tex]z = \dfrac{X - \mu}{\sigma}[/tex]
[tex]z = \dfrac{1437 - 982}{198}[/tex]
[tex]z = \dfrac{455}{198}[/tex]
z =2.30
The equivalent ACT Score = 19.6 + (2.30 × 4.5)
The equivalent ACT Score = 19.6 + 10.35
The equivalent ACT Score = 29.95

27 – 4 + 2a = 4a + 10 what is the answer
Answer:
13/2 = a
Step-by-step explanation:
27 – 4 + 2a = 4a + 10
Combine like terms
23 +2a = 4a +10
Subtract 2a from each side
23+2a-2a = 4a-2a +10
23 = 2a+10
Subtract 10 from each side
23-10 = 2a+10-10
13 = 2a
Divide by 2
13/2 = a

The diagonal of a square is 8 cm. What is the length of the side of this square? Give your answer as an exact surd in its simplest form.
Answer:
4[tex]\sqrt{2}[/tex] cm
Step-by-step explanation:
The diagonal divides the square into 2 right angles with legs s and the diagonal as the hypotenuse.
Using Pythagoras' identity in the right triangle , then
s² + s² = 8²
2s² = 64 ( divide both sides by 2 )
s² = 32 ( take the square root of both sides )
s = [tex]\sqrt{32}[/tex] = 4[tex]\sqrt{2}[/tex]

S(t) = -105t + 945 to determine the salvage value, S(t), in dollars, of a table saw t years after its purchase. How long will it take the saw to depreciate completely? A. 11 years B. 8 years C. 7 years D. 9 years
Answer:
D
Step-by-step explanation:
When something depreciates completely, it will have a total value of 0 dollars. Therefore, set the equation to zero and solve for t to find the years.
[tex]S(t)=-105t+945\\0=-105t+945\\-105t=-945\\t=9[/tex]
Therefore, the table saw will completely depreciate after 9 years.
